Worth a punt
As a young lad of 10-11, I was going through a load of storage boxes in my wardrobe when I stumbled across a diary from 1962 - my mum's no less. Nothing juicy in it at all except across 2 pages, written by John Lennon, To RickGrimes Mum, love the Beatles, followed by all 4 signatures.
"Do you know what these are Mum?"
"Course I do, it's the Beatles autographs, I met them backstage before they got famous, wondered where they'd gone"
"Worth a few quid these ma?"
"Nah, just an old diary isn't it?"

Oh, alright mum, I'll have them when you're done then.
